Co-op Marque unveiled by International Co-operative Alliance

19 December 2013

MARQUEThe United Nations support for an International Year of Co-operatives (IYC) in 2012 galvanized the global movement across every region and every sector uniting co-operatives behind a single logo and tagline.

The International Co-operative Alliance, eager to build on the success of the International Year,  has developed a global co-operative identity that all co-operatives can align with to differentiate from other businesses and display a unity of purpose.

The Business Council of Co-operatives and Mutuals will be assisting any Australian co-operatives in obtaining use of the marque from the ICA. Please email [email protected] with any inquiries.
